引言
PostgreSQL是一种开源的对象关系数据库管理系统(ORDBMS),它有着丰富的功能和强大的扩展性。它能够处理大量数据,并具有高可靠性、可扩展性和安全性,是企业级的数据库管理系统。下面将会详细讲解如何使用PostgreSQL登录。
正文
一、安装PostgreSQL
在使用PostgreSQL前,需要在本地或服务器上先安装它。可以到 PostgreSQL官网 下载所需的安装包。
下载PostgreSQL安装包
执行PostgreSQL安装程序
安装完成后,启动PostgreSQL服务器
二、创建数据库
成功安装PostgreSQL后,需要创建一个数据库才能进行操作,下面是操作步骤:
1. 运行以下命令登录到PostgreSQL服务器:
$ sudo -u postgres psql
2. 创建新的数据库:
CREATE DATABASE mydatabase;
注意:在创建数据库时,需要确保数据库名称唯一且没有任何空格。
三、创建用户
要用PostgreSQL登录,首先需要添加一个用户,接下来是用户创建步骤:
1. 运行以下命令登录到PostgreSQL服务器:
$ sudo -u postgres psql
2. 创建新的用户:
CREATE USER myuser WITH PASSWORD 'mypassword';
3. 授予权限:
GRANT ALL PRIVILEGES ON DATABASE mydatabase TO myuser;
这样就创建了一个名为myuser
,密码为mypassword
的新用户,并授予访问mydatabase
的权限。
四、使用命令行登录
使用以下命令行在命令行界面登录到PostgreSQL:
psql -d mydatabase -U myuser -h localhost -p 5432
注:其中mydatabase
是你创建的数据库名称,myuser
是你创建的用户名,localhost
是服务器名。
五、使用GUI登录
可以使用多种图形用户界面(GUI)工具登录到PostgreSQL,下面是其中之一的实例:
- 从 pgAdmin 官网上下载和安装pgAdmin。
- 启动pgAdmin并连接到PostgreSQL服务器。
- 如果是首次连接,需要先创建一个服务器对象并设置服务器参数。
- 使用
myuser
和mypassword
登录到PostgreSQL服务器。
结论
这篇文章介绍了如何用PostgreSQL登录。首先需要安装PostgreSQL和创建数据库和用户,然后可以使用命令行或GUI工具登录到PostgreSQL。PostgreSQL具有强大的功能和扩展性,是企业级的数据库管理系统。